The beach walk from the Marques hotel at the Colonial Sant Jordi end is very textile as you would imagine. You are then walking for twenty minutes down a very pretty beach and expecting more seclusion. Unfortunately at around that twenty minute point you are met by the textile car arrivals from a car park in the Salines national park. So you have to walk on again. It is then a delicate balance so as not to go too far and meet the textiles from Corvettes! All good fun though. Every day there are loads of nudies and we have had a lovely time. There is a restaurant off the mid stretch of the beach which is great for a break. The dunes behind are supposedly off bounds for environmental reasons but there a few roaming men. It is very hot back there out of the sea breeze and we have not seen any couples sunning themselves there. |
